Vass has now finished the negotiations with Ilcea, and shoes with the museum calf/Radica-leather will cost €520. So it's a €100 up charge from the standard leathers, which is a bit unfortunate, but still a good price. Apparently they will also source some other "interesting" new Ilcea-leathers as well, but don't know which those are yet though.
